Transaction 5bba90bd70c811be23b5ba2467cc03bf19ab53590fc673532d62a23a105572ed
1 Input
1 Output
-
5bba90bd70c811be23b5ba2467cc03bf19ab53590fc673532d62a23a105572ed:0
- value
- 23094008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fa99364ddda8e5466ca5cfc011e4f52d9566a00 OP_EQUAL
- address
- 3EndhJggpGZfYgGqbBRa4PB4KcQAdyzSZd